Offered by: Translation (School of Continuing Studies)

Overview

Translation : In this course students will study the main trends in translation in the West from Antiquity to the present. Through a study of the most significant approaches to translation and the representatives of the different schools of thought through the ages, students will obtain an overview of the development of the profession. The course consists of two major parts: A diachronic study of language mediation and its role within the different cultures and the in-depth study of specific topics of outstanding importance within the evolution or translation. / Ce cours porte sur les grands courants de la traduction en Occident, de l'Antiquit茅 脿 l'茅poque moderne.
